首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

外部连接Pandas Dataframe

外部连接(Outer Join)是一种在关系型数据库中用于合并两个或多个表的操作。在Pandas中,可以使用外部连接来合并多个Dataframe,以便进行数据分析和处理。

外部连接可以分为左外连接(Left Outer Join)、右外连接(Right Outer Join)和全外连接(Full Outer Join)三种类型。

左外连接(Left Outer Join):返回左表中的所有记录,以及右表中与左表匹配的记录。如果右表中没有与左表匹配的记录,则用NaN填充。

右外连接(Right Outer Join):返回右表中的所有记录,以及左表中与右表匹配的记录。如果左表中没有与右表匹配的记录,则用NaN填充。

全外连接(Full Outer Join):返回左表和右表中的所有记录,如果左表或右表中没有匹配的记录,则用NaN填充。

外部连接在以下情况下常用:

  1. 合并多个数据源:当需要将多个数据源中的数据进行合并时,可以使用外部连接来保留所有数据。
  2. 数据分析和处理:外部连接可以用于将多个Dataframe中的数据按照某个共同的列进行合并,以便进行数据分析和处理。
  3. 数据库查询:在关系型数据库中,外部连接可以用于查询多个表中的数据。

在腾讯云的产品中,可以使用腾讯云的云数据库 TencentDB 进行数据存储和管理。TencentDB 提供了多种数据库类型,如 MySQL、SQL Server、MongoDB 等,可以满足不同的业务需求。您可以通过腾讯云官网(https://cloud.tencent.com/product/cdb)了解更多关于 TencentDB 的信息和产品介绍。

此外,腾讯云还提供了云服务器(CVM)和云函数(SCF)等产品,用于支持云计算和应用部署。您可以通过腾讯云官网(https://cloud.tencent.com/product/cvm)和(https://cloud.tencent.com/product/scf)了解更多相关信息。

请注意,以上只是腾讯云的一些产品示例,其他云计算品牌商也提供类似的产品和服务,具体选择应根据实际需求和预算来决定。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券